JtoJ volunteer Livia di Benedetto is running a series of workshops about refugees and asylum seekers
The second workshop, The Journey and Its Challenges, will focus on the journey they are forced to make in order to find safety. According to the Universal Declaration of Human Rights, “everyone has the right to seek asylum from persecution” but why is it so difficult in practice? Why is the irregular way to enter a country used more often than the regular way? What are the legal options? Why do some states build walls rather than bridges? We will try to answer these questions and others with activities, debate and presentations.
